Since 2009, the Korean Culture and Information Service has established multiple Korean Cultural Centers around the world. The Korean Cultural Centers emphasize activities and events that contribute to an understanding of Korea and Korean culture at a deeper level. In response to the increasing demand for greater public awareness of Korean culture as well as the rise of 'Hallyu', the Korean Cultural Centers offer diverse programs that give people an opportunity to first-handedly experience Korea and Korean [[Culture|culture]]. The Korean Culture Centers utilize social networking services to introduce Korean culture and to deliver news concerning the Cultural Centers in a more effective manner. Through these services, it has been possible to reach people all over the world.
